From 5f0704b66cea73cf2ab148ec4cff645cc301fd8c Mon Sep 17 00:00:00 2001 From: Florian Weimer Date: Thu, 31 Aug 2017 14:07:23 +0200 Subject: libio: Assume _LIBC, weak_alias, errno, (__set_)errno &c are defined Do not define _POSIX_SOURCE. --- libio/iogetwline.c | 10 +++------- 1 file changed, 3 insertions(+), 7 deletions(-) (limited to 'libio/iogetwline.c') diff --git a/libio/iogetwline.c b/libio/iogetwline.c index e60a590..535f903 100644 --- a/libio/iogetwline.c +++ b/libio/iogetwline.c @@ -28,10 +28,6 @@ #include #include -#ifdef _LIBC -# define wmemcpy __wmemcpy -#endif - _IO_size_t _IO_getwline (_IO_FILE *fp, wchar_t *buf, _IO_size_t n, wint_t delim, int extract_delim) @@ -98,12 +94,12 @@ _IO_getwline_info (_IO_FILE *fp, wchar_t *buf, _IO_size_t n, wint_t delim, if (extract_delim > 0) ++len; } - wmemcpy ((void *) ptr, (void *) fp->_wide_data->_IO_read_ptr, - len); + __wmemcpy ((void *) ptr, (void *) fp->_wide_data->_IO_read_ptr, + len); fp->_wide_data->_IO_read_ptr = t; return old_len + len; } - wmemcpy ((void *) ptr, (void *) fp->_wide_data->_IO_read_ptr, len); + __wmemcpy ((void *) ptr, (void *) fp->_wide_data->_IO_read_ptr, len); fp->_wide_data->_IO_read_ptr += len; ptr += len; n -= len; -- cgit v1.1